Chelsea Looking To Appeal Against Transfer Ban And Bring In This Serie A Ace

Chelsea are reportedly looking to appeal against transfer ban which has been imposed on them by UEFA just a few days ago. They are also looking to make an attempt at bringing in the AC Milan midfield ace Alessio Romagnoli to Stamford Bridge in the next summer.

The Blues have been looking to make a mark this season after their recent downfall. After losing consecutive matches in the Premier League by Bournemouth and Manchester City by significant margins and being knocked out of the FA Cup by close rivals Manchester United, they lost their last encounter in the League Cup against Manchester City to lose out on an opportunity to lift a silverware. Their midfield has not performed anywhere near expectations this season, especially Jorginho, who has been a big failure under the tactics of the new manager Maurizio Sarri.

In this condition, the Blues might look to bring in Romagnoli to add steel to their midfield. However, it might not be easy for them with the AC Milan gaffer Gennaro Gattuso not willing to let the influential midfielder and captain leave San Siro in the next summer. The player has a contract to stay at the Serie A club until 2022 and it is to be seen whether Chelsea can get over their transfer ban and pull off the signing of the Italian midfield ace.
